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Компоненты Delphi
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.07.2010, 15:28   #1
docbrain
Заблокирован
 
Регистрация: 14.01.2010
Сообщений: 306
По умолчанию TStaticText не слушается.

Доброе время суток.
У меня нижеследующая проблема. Компонент TStaticText, который как я читал, должен отображать многострочный текст, ничего такого не делает. Ведет себя так же как обычный TLabel, при установке AutoSize в False, просто тянет строку где-то у себя за пределами.
docbrain вне форума Ответить с цитированием
Старый 17.07.2010, 15:40   #2
Korben5E
Форумчанин
 
Аватар для Korben5E
 
Регистрация: 13.07.2010
Сообщений: 346
По умолчанию

а чем плох TLabel и WordWrap := true ?
Non est culpa vin, sed culpa bibentis
Korben5E вне форума Ответить с цитированием
Старый 17.07.2010, 16:39   #3
docbrain
Заблокирован
 
Регистрация: 14.01.2010
Сообщений: 306
По умолчанию

Цитата:
а чем плох TLabel и WordWrap := true ?
И что?!
Попробовал я так сделать. Результат - нулевой.
docbrain вне форума Ответить с цитированием
Старый 17.07.2010, 16:47   #4
Пепел Феникса
Старожил
 
Аватар для Пепел Феникса
 
Регистрация: 28.01.2009
Сообщений: 21,000
По умолчанию

TLabel
AutoSize:=false;
WordWrap:=true;
(на крайняк можно насильно ставить перевод строки)
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ел.
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ите.
Пепел Феникса вне форума Ответить с цитированием
Старый 17.07.2010, 18:19   #5
DIgorevich
Погулять вышел
Участник клуба
 
Аватар для DIgorevich
 
Регистрация: 17.05.2010
Сообщений: 1,573
По умолчанию

docbrain.
Может Вы ширину статика или лейблы оставляли однострочной?
Никогда не знаешь, где тебе повезет... (Фрай)
DIgorevich вне форума Ответить с цитированием
Старый 17.07.2010, 20:06   #6
docbrain
Заблокирован
 
Регистрация: 14.01.2010
Сообщений: 306
По умолчанию

Цитата:
TLabel
AutoSize:=false;
WordWrap:=true;
Я так и делал.

Цитата:
docbrain.
Может Вы ширину статика или лейблы оставляли однострочной?
О чем вы? О каком свойстве?
docbrain вне форума Ответить с цитированием
Старый 17.07.2010, 20:12   #7
DIgorevich
Погулять вышел
Участник клуба
 
Аватар для DIgorevich
 
Регистрация: 17.05.2010
Сообщений: 1,573
По умолчанию

Цитата:
Сообщение от docbrain Посмотреть сообщение
Я так и делал.
О чем вы? О каком свойстве?
Это свойство называется Height. Смотрите вложение:

1.JPG

2.JPG
Никогда не знаешь, где тебе повезет... (Фрай)
DIgorevich вне форума Ответить с цитированием
Старый 17.07.2010, 20:35   #8
docbrain
Заблокирован
 
Регистрация: 14.01.2010
Сообщений: 306
По умолчанию

Где вы задали такие параметры?
docbrain вне форума Ответить с цитированием
Старый 17.07.2010, 20:41   #9
DIgorevich
Погулять вышел
Участник клуба
 
Аватар для DIgorevich
 
Регистрация: 17.05.2010
Сообщений: 1,573
По умолчанию

Что значит "где"? Когда кидаешь на форму компонент, его потом можно растягивать как угодно. Относительно TLabel пишем свойства
AutoSize:=false;
WordWrap:=true;
А потом растягиваем.
Никогда не знаешь, где тебе повезет... (Фрай)
DIgorevich вне форума Ответить с цитированием
Старый 17.07.2010, 20:55   #10
docbrain
Заблокирован
 
Регистрация: 14.01.2010
Сообщений: 306
По умолчанию

Я так и делал. Только на следующую строку он не переходит. Так и фигачит одной строкой по прямой. Ну да, к краю формы не ползет. Ну так мне не это нужно.
docbrain в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Программа не слушается условия [D7, XP] DriverSTi Общие вопросы Delphi 17 09.01.2010 18:18
TStaticText + XPMan = проблемы со шрифтом Аццкий прогер Компоненты Delphi 1 13.03.2009 15:44